Shiro 授予身份及切换身份.pdfVIP

  • 47
  • 0
  • 约5.15千字
  • 约 5页
  • 2017-06-12 发布于北京
  • 举报
Shiro 授予⾝份和切换⾝份 授予⾝份及切换⾝份 在⼀些场景中,⽐如某个领导因为⼀些原因不能进⾏登录⽹站进⾏⼀些操作,他想把 他⽹站上的 作委托给他的秘书,但是他不想把帐号 / 密码告诉他秘书,只是想把 作委托给他;此时和我们可以使⽤ Shiro 的 RunAs 功能,即允许⼀个⽤户假装为另⼀ 个⽤户 (如果他们允许)的⾝份进⾏访问。 本章代码基于 《第⼗六章 综合实例》,请先了解相关数据模型及基本流程后再学习本 章。 表及数据 SQL 请运⾏ shiro-example-chapter2 1/sql/ shiro-schema.sql 表结构 请运⾏ shiro-example-chapter2 1/sql/ shiro-schema.sql 数据 实体 具体请参考 com .github .zhangkaitao .shiro .chapter2 1 包下的实体。 public class UserRunAs implements Serializable { private Long fromUserId;//授予身份帐号 private Long toUserId;//被授予身份帐号 }nbsp; 该实体定义了授予⾝份帐号 (A )与被授予⾝份帐号 (B )的关系,意思是

您可能关注的文档

文档评论(0)

1亿VIP精品文档

相关文档